Output 770371e7292ee419b233aba789c38a6db909041af88f301dc375e4403447c7bb:0

value
69341642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301bf46fe0edf44a3b7a9647bf11fd6b50458733 OP_EQUAL
address
365Pr62GpsjgBf184uXYxzxRLg9pGJuA9b
transaction
770371e7292ee419b233aba789c38a6db909041af88f301dc375e4403447c7bb
confirmations
310885
spent
true